From: Hannes Reinecke ICH6 spec defines the PORT_ bits as: PORT_ENABLED (R/W): 0 = Disabled. The port is in the off state and cannot detect any devices. 1 = Enabled. The port can transition between the on, partial, and slumber states and can detect devices. PORT_PRESENT (R/O) The status of this bit may change at any time. This bit is cleared when the port is disabled via PORT_ENABLED. This bit is not cleared upon surprise removal of a device. So from a textual view it is not necessary that PORT_PRESENT _must_ be set, especially if a device detection has to be done anyway. And, in fact, this is the view that ACER has been taken with its new Laptops (e.g. Travelmate 4150). And the definition of PORT_ENABLED / PORT_PRESENT is mixed up, btw.
